    Definitely BT is the best option, I’ve been using it “thuricide” since spring when I planted and I haven’t seen any budworms and it works on aphids. Doesn’t harm any beneficial or the plants. I spray weekly as a preventative, good luck!

    Thanks for this. I've been dealing w/ budworms on my petunias for a few years already...It was a war & they usually won. I didn't pot petunias for a few years because I felt so defeated by these little monsters. I decided to pot them this year and lo...budworms like crazy. I never had budworms on my petunias when I lived in Michigan, I can't figure out why, unless folks just use more intense pesticides in the area I lived? Since living in IL I have gotten them every time I pot petunias. I have found eggs under the tender leaves...worms of all sizes. Like you, I follow the poop and will usually find them. I tried to keep up, but it seems like a losing battle yet again. I do think the birds & hornets/wasps help to destroy them, even spiders, but it's not enough. I have pulled off worms as tiny as a needle about 1/4 in long to the fat ones. It's a struggle... Thanks again & GOOD LUCK!

      @@ChicagoGardener I just noticed them on my petunias over the last few days. I have used the Capt Jack's Deadbug brew successfully in the past. The active ingredient is Spinosad. Then spray weekly to keep them away. I find I didn't have the patience to hunt for the caterpillars. In the past, I've never seen any budworm damage before late July. Things are happening early this year.
